About The Position

Referral Specialist requires attention to detail with reviewing orders/ referrals for specialty scheduling with multiple resources and coordination of appointments. Requires both registration and insurance verification for a smooth arrival / check in and check out process. General Office duties while maintaining medical records and multiple inbox messaging pools. This is an in-office patient facing role with multiple touch points with patients and families. Applicant should have a strong customer service experience and medical office experience preferred. Requirements

  • Medical Office experience
  • Requires High School diploma or equivalent.
  • Requires 2-4 years of relevant experience.
  • Minimum one-year medical office experience or combination of extensive customer service work experience and education in insurance verification, patient registration, and medical terminology.
  • Requires working knowledge of payer billing requirements, regulations, and the third party appeal and denial process.

Nice To Haves

  • Prefer experiences with scheduling
  • Cerner skills a plus

Responsibilities

  • Patient experience with referral review and scheduling appropriately with correct providers and resources
  • Professional Phone Skills
  • Working as a team to cover all front office duties – faxing, managing messaging, registration check in, and insurance reviews
  • Positive demeanor
  • Quick learner or previous Cerner experience
